Sweden Faces Rising Costs: New Fees and Electricity Price Concerns for 2026
Swedish households and businesses are bracing for a series of new and increased fees impacting both everyday expenses and long-term financial planning. From anticipated impact fees on new construction to the introduction of a new electricity fee in 2026, and ongoing concerns about electricity prices, financial pressures are mounting. These changes are prompting a reevaluation of consumption habits and a closer look at the economic landscape.
The impending impact fees, as highlighted by agricultural news sources, are expected to significantly increase the cost of building and development. This will likely affect housing affordability and potentially slow down construction projects. Simultaneously, a new electricity fee, slated to take effect in 2026, is raising concerns about household budgets. Experts suggest that adjusting daily energy consumption is crucial to mitigate the financial impact of these changes.
Understanding the New Fees: A Comprehensive Breakdown
The introduction of a new electricity fee in 2026 is a direct response to the need for infrastructure investment and grid modernization. As Sweden transitions towards a more sustainable energy system, significant upgrades are required to ensure reliability and capacity. This fee, while intended to support long-term improvements, will inevitably add to the cost of electricity for consumers. Fortum’s analysis of the 2025 electricity year and projections for 2026 emphasize the importance of proactive energy management.
Beyond the electricity fee, the anticipated impact fees represent a shift in how development projects are financed. Traditionally, infrastructure costs were often absorbed by municipalities. However, with growing demands and limited public funds, developers are increasingly being asked to contribute directly to the cost of new infrastructure, such as roads, schools, and utilities. This shift is expected to have a ripple effect throughout the construction industry and the housing market.
Swedish Radio reports that even small changes in daily habits can significantly impact electricity bills. Simple adjustments, such as using energy-efficient appliances, reducing standby power consumption, and optimizing heating and cooling systems, can collectively lead to substantial savings.
